// GraphQL N+1 fix for the Ordergrove schema.
// Resolvers previously issued one Tidebase query per child node;
// a 50-item order page meant 200+ round trips. We now batch via
// a per-request dataloader with a short flush window and bounded
// batch size. Oversized batches split automatically. Reviewers:
// check the batching constants below against staging latency.

constants for bawif-kawif:
QUOTAS = {
    "ulaael": 5,
    "holael": 10,
}

Taking over Fablecrate from me means inheriting the factory library that seeds test data for all of Brindlemoor's integration suites. The factories are declarative; each model definition lives in its own module, and sequences reset per test run unless you opt into persistent mode. Known quirk: the relationship resolver chokes on circular foreign keys, so the order-and-invoice factories use deferred builders. Tam documented that pattern in the wiki. Everything runs off one config file, reproduced here for reference.

settings of fafog-haduf:
ZORIX_PIN=4648
ZORIX_METRICS_HOST=metrics.zorix.paliqsys.corp
ZORIX_LOG_LEVEL=info
ZORIX_TENANT=druix

Alert: DeepRoute link resolution failures exceeding threshold in the Fennelworks mobile SDK. When a deep link arrives while the host app is cold-starting, the router may resolve against a stale plugin manifest, sending users to a fallback screen instead of your registered handler. Plugin authors should verify that route declarations are registered before the first lifecycle callback, and avoid mutating route tables at runtime. This alert fires when fallback rate tops 2% over fifteen minutes. Detailed triage guidance lives on the internal page.

operations page: https://vault.qirvanhq.local/ticket

Ticket: Config drift on Feedwarden validators

The Feedwarden podcast feed validator nodes in the Oakmire pool have drifted from the baseline. Node 3 rejects enclosures over 250MB while the others allow 500MB, so customers get inconsistent validation results depending on which node handles the request. Support: if a customer reports a feed passing one minute and failing the next, tag this ticket instead of opening a new one. Fix is to reapply the baseline via the Anchorline tool. The expected baseline values are as follows.

service settings:
[casax]
port = 6379
team = rusir
host = casax.zemvarhq.corp
region = outer-4
access_code = ac_9808ce
timeout_ms = 1500